His Hand in All Things
Well what a day we had yesterday. Joey taught his first Gospel Doctrine lesson and did amazing. He was so relaxed and well prepared. He delivered his lesson with a calm confidence that I was envious of. Yesterday I was called to be the second counselor in the Relief Society. Talk about feeling unprepared for a calling. I will be serving with Janet Scott and the Bishop's wife Serene so I know that they will help me a ton. Then last night we got a call from the Bishop asking us to speak this coming Sunday. Are you kidding me Heavenly Father? was the first thought. I was already feeling tremendously overwhelmed and know we have to prepare talks. Although I feel like this is all too much I feel calm in knowing that I am not alone in any of this. I know that Heavenly Father and my Savior will be with me every step of the way. I was given a little reminder of this constant companionship this morning. I was cleaning up the kitchen and I realized that one of my invisalign trays was missing from the counter. Not the best place to put them but in the midst of yesterday's crazy morning I had set them there. I searched drawers and even the trash and could not find them. I prayed to Heavenly Father that I would be able to find them. I called Joey and asked him about it and he told me of three other trash bags they might be in. I searched through the bags and was able to find them. I knelt immediately in the laundry room and thanked my Heavenly Father for helping me. It made me realize once again that He will help me if I just ask. Whether it be for something as small as finding my braces or something as great as taking on a new calling. He is there for me and I could not feel more comforted or grateful.
